Segment Theme Poem by Alex McCullough

Segment Theme



The foolish me inside submitted to the night,
Question after Question, I couldn't make out the words,
Only the silence which called out to me.
Count the dreams you've dropped,
The ones you should've kept with you,
They were innocent times,
Just drowned in the color of the night,
Sadness has swallowed my world,
Just as these regrets are now my moon,
But that glimmer in the middle of this,
Could it really be the hope known as future?
Keep me as a segment theme,
Emotions just wandering around,
My hands can't reach the sky,
But they can grab ahold of you, the star.
Hot like new life just emerged,
This dawn of mine rises quickly,
So to cut the darkness out of the way,
And allow our moment to exist once more.
Call me down like making a wish,
And I'll see it as my only tomorrow,
The loneliness inside me,
Can only tolerate night for so long.
Keep setting the stage,
So we can see how it all plays out.
